Developing a strategic marketing plan is crucial for any business looking to drive results and achieve its goals. A well-thought-out plan can help you reach your target audience, increase sales, and build brand awareness. In this article, we will discuss how to develop a strategic marketing plan that drives results.

1. Set Clear Goals: The first step in developing a strategic marketing plan is to set clear and specific goals. These goals should be measurable and achievable, and they should align with your overall business objectives. Whether your goal is to increase website traffic, generate leads, or boost sales, it’s important to have a clear vision of what you want to accomplish.

2. Know Your Target Audience: Understanding your target audience is essential for developing a successful marketing plan. Take the time to research your audience’s demographics, interests, and buying behaviors. This information will help you create targeted marketing campaigns that resonate with your target market.

3. Conduct a SWOT Analysis: Before developing your marketing plan, it’s important to conduct a SWOT analysis to assess your business’s str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ats. This will help you identify areas where you can capitalize on your strengths and address any weaknesses or threats that may hinder your success.

4. Develop a Unique Value Proposition: A strong value proposition is essential for standing out in a crowded marketplace. Clearly articulate what sets your business apart from the competition and how your products or services can benefit your target audience. Your value proposition should be the foundation of your marketing messaging.

5. Choose the Right Marketing Channels: When developing your marketing plan, consider which channels will be most effective in reaching your target audience. Whether it’s social media, email marketing, content marketing, or traditional advertising, it’s important to choose the channels that will best reach and engage your audience.

6. Create a Content Calendar: Consistent and relevant content is key to a successful marketing plan. Create a content calendar that outlines the topics, formats, and delivery dates for your content. This will help you stay organized and ensure that you are consistently providing value to your audience.

7. Monitor and Measure Results: Once you have implemented your marketing plan, it’s important to monitor and measure the results of your efforts. Use analytics tools to track key performance indicators such as website traffic, conversion rates, and social media engagement. This data will help you identify what is working well and where you may need to make adjustments.

In conclusion, developing a strategic marketing plan that drives results requires careful planning, research, and execution. By setting clear goals, knowing your target audience, conducting a SWOT analysis, and choosing the right marketing channels, you can create a plan that will help you achieve your business objectives. Remember to consistently monitor and measure your results and make adjustments as needed to continue driving success.
